I want to distinguish between servers which are down and servers which have stopped splunkd service. After that I need to create a button in Dashboard which will trigger a script which will go to the respective server and take the necessary action.

Currently our client wants a dashboard where we can see the down agents and a button after that to trigger a script that will up the Splunk agent.

Please tell whether it's possible or not ?

In theory, it's possible... You'll likely want to pull data and APIs from your Endpoint Monitoring/Management solution (something like Tanium), and you probably also want to bring in data from your change management/ticketing system, inventory & asset management, and configuration management systems as well.

But as you develop such make sure you are considering the security implications of having that button as well, guard against the possibility of someone being able to pervert the ability to start a service to become an arbitrary privileged command and control mechanism across your client's enterprise.
